H & H Ranch

Houston, TX

H & H Ranch, located in the vibrant city of Houston, TX, is an entertainment company that specializes in creating immersive experiences for guests of all ages. With a focus on family-friendly activities, the ranch features a range of attractions, including live shows, educational programs, and outdoor adventures that celebrate the spirit of Texas. Ideal for gatherings and celebrations, H & H Ranch is a lively destination where fun and community come together.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esTexasHoustonH & H Ranch

Partial Data by Foursquare.